Product details
Overview
BZX8850S-C6V2-QYL from Nexperia is a low-current Zener voltage regulator diode in the BZX8850S-Q series, designed for precision voltage reference and regulation in space-constrained, low-power circuits. It delivers a nominal 6.2 V Zener voltage at 50 µA test current, with ±2 % tolerance (C-series), 160 Ω dynamic resistance at 5 mA, and 0.4 mV/K temperature coefficient - optimized for battery-powered sensor nodes and automotive body electronics.
For engineers reviewing the BZX8850S-C6V2-QYL datasheet, BZX8850S-C6V2-QYL pinout, BZX8850S-C6V2-QYL application, or BZX8850S-C6V2-QYL equivalent, key selection criteria include its ultra-low 50 µA regulation current, side-wettable DFN1006BD-2 package for automated optical inspection, AEC-Q101 qualification, and intentional leakage tuning for noise-sensitive analog front-ends.
Technical Context
This Zener diode operates in reverse breakdown mode with a specified working voltage of 5.89 V to 6.51 V at IZ = 50 µA, exhibiting tight differential resistance (160 Ω max at 5 mA) and low thermal drift (±0.4 mV/K). Its design targets stable biasing under minimal current draw, avoiding thermal runaway in thermally isolated PCB layouts.
The device uses a silicon planar epitaxial process and features side-wettable flanks for solder-joint reliability verification. Unlike standard Zeners, the C-series variant includes controlled leakage current elevation to suppress switching transients and reduce high-frequency noise coupling in signal conditioning paths.

FAQ
What is the maximum reverse current (IR) at 5.0 V for BZX8850S-C6V2-QYL?
At VR = 5.0 V and Tj = 25 °C, the maximum reverse current is 1.0 µA. This value reflects the diode's tight leakage control in the pre-breakdown region, supporting low-power standby modes in always-on sensor interfaces without compromising battery life.
Can BZX8850S-C6V2-QYL be used in parallel for higher power handling?
No - Zener diodes exhibit negative temperature coefficients and mismatched breakdown characteristics that cause current hogging when paralleled. The device is rated for 365 mW total dissipation on FR4; higher power must be achieved via external series resistance or alternative topology.
Is the cathode marking visible under standard AOI systems?
Yes - the cathode is marked with a visible bar on the top surface of the DFN1006BD-2 package, and the side-wettable flanks enable reliable solder-joint inspection using standard 2D/3D AOI equipment calibrated for 0.6 mm pitch components.
Does the +0.4 mV/K temperature coefficient apply across the full operating range?
The +0.4 mV/K value is typical at 25 °C and applies within the 0 °C to 70 °C range; outside this, the coefficient increases nonlinearly up to +2.5 mV/K at 125 °C. System-level calibration should account for this curvature in high-accuracy applications.
